Sustained UnprofitabilityPersistent negative operating and net margins indicate the business is not generating operating returns on assets, eroding retained earnings and limiting reinvestment. Over months this undermines competitive capacity to maintain plants, invest in efficiencies, or compete on pricing.
High LeverageElevated debt levels materially raise fixed obligations and refinancing risk, especially in capital-intensive cement production. High leverage constrains strategic flexibility, increases vulnerability to interest-rate cycles, and can force asset sales or capital raises during downturns.
Weak Cash GenerationDeclining operating cash flow and negative free cash flow weaken liquidity and the ability to fund maintenance capex or service debt from operations. Structurally weak cash conversion raises long-term solvency concerns and limits the firm's capacity to invest in growth initiatives.
